Excelsior form and stats

Overall Eerste Divisie stats at home this season for Excelsior are 6-1-7 (wins-draw-losses). Two home wins in a row for Excelsior bring valid hopes of a third.

Excelsior shared the glory with De Graafschap in their last match, an away game that ended all square 1-1. Previous to that game, a home match hosting Jong Utrecht in a game that was won 2-0.

The Excelsior goalkeeper Alessandro Damen was crucial in the match against De Graafschap last time out, making seven saves.

With an average of more than two goals per home game in the league (30 in 14 games), Excelsior's attacking play is working. With more than 1,5 conceded goals on average, the Excelsior defense is not exactly impregnable. 26 goals conceded from 14 games. You can find more goal stats on the Statistics tab above.

Helmond Sport form and stats

The hunting on away grounds haven’t been very fruitful for Helmond Sport so far with only 13 points returning home. The records show 2-7-5 (win-draw-lose). Travelling has not been lucrative for the away team as they have returned home without a win in ten away games in a row.

Helmond Sport go into this game after a win, the home game against Jong Utrecht that ended 2-1. It was a defeat before that one as the away game against NAC Breda wasn't a success with a 2-3 loss.

Scoring goals is the main ingredient in creating success in football, and not only at home. So far Helmond have scored 19 goals in 14 league games away. Helmond's defence is not exactly unbeatable as they have conceded 24 goals from these trips.

Head 2 Head

Excelsior and Helmond Sport have met before this season: Helmond Sport - Excelsior 2-1. Numbers for the last ten meetings between these two teams are: five wins for Excelsior, three draws and two wins for Helmond Sport. Over 2,5 goals: nine times; under 2,5 goals: one game.

The Eerste Divisie, meaning “First Division”, is the second highest level of football in the Netherlands. 20 teams play two fixtures against each other to form a final league table after 380 games. The winning team is promoted with a creative playoff system deciding whether more teams promote.
